Greyhound Café @ Ansa : Weekday Lunch Menu Launched

October 24, 2017 By StrawberrY Gal - Food Review, Invited Review Leave a Comment

Malaysia’s first offshoot of Thailand’s Greyhound Cafe is open where they are one of the well known brands in Thailand. Greyhound is one of the fashionable casual dining café opened in Malaysia back in March 2016 where they has been serving loads of trendy modern comfort food. They had one in Ansa Hotel in between the two busy mall which are the Lot 10 and also Fahrenheit 88.
The café interior is beautiful and it is indeed a chic and contemporary ambiance which makes it so Instagram friendly.
We were there last week to try their lunch set where they have 6 new Weekday Menu. The Weekday Delight Lunch comes with a variety choices of food to go for either noodles or rice and a free drink.
We started with the Pad Thai with Fresh Shrimps (RM 26). We loved how the pad thai was done. We do enjoyed them so much especially the thin rice noodles was perfectly well fried with the tamarind sauce, egg, fresh prawns, tofu, bean sprouts and chives. Sides with the lime at the side. Together with it was the dried chili flakes, crushed peanuts and the fresh bean sprouts. The pad thai was flavourful and aromatic; well stir fried till perfection with generous portion of fresh bouncy shrimps.
Noodle with Braised Beef Soup (RM 26)
The hearty bowl of pipping hot soup was divinely good. The soup was flavourful and the noodles texture was perfect. We love the QQ texture of the noodles. There were also generous portion of the beef that were being served with it as well.
Spaghetti Carbonara in Light Cream Sauce (RM 26)
Cooked al-dente, the spaghetti Carbonara was just a perfect divine. The light cream sauce had made a good match with the spaghetti itself. It was pretty heavy but the taste was good.
Spaghetti with Thai Anchovy (RM26) 
Another signature here was the Spaghetti with Thai Anchovy (RM26).  Using the Thai ingredients in their cooking paired with the al-dente pasta, the dish was perfect. The taste was just robust with the combination of spicy and salty.
Minced Chicken with Sweet Basil (RM 27) 
We tried the minced chicken with Sweet Basil where the rice set was perfectly prepared.  The chicken was well minced till perfection with the hint of basil in it. The taste was perfectly awesome and had a light spicy hint.
Fried Rice with Shrimp Paste (RM 27) 
I was in love with their fried rice with shrimp paste. Well fried , with the aromatic and robust flavours from the shrimp paste. Perfectly good.
